Compact Machine Site Preparation: When is it Right ?

Using a compact excavator for property clearing can be a efficient solution , but it's not always the ideal choice. This method excels when dealing with limited areas, overgrown brush, and gentle terrain. It’s especially suited for projects like clearing space for patios , minor demolition, or leveling limited parcels . However, if you're facing a expansive space, significant timber, or significantly tough conditions, a more substantial piece of equipment or a different approach might be better .

How Much Does Land Clearing Really Cost?

Figuring out a cost of land removal can be incredibly complex . Several elements affect the final sum. You might anticipate a basic charge per acre, but in reality , this is significantly more involved. Expenses generally fall anywhere from $3-$8 per square foot , but this serves as merely a rough projection . Considerations including the land's gradient , vegetation density , existence of debris, and local employment fees all play a significant role . Moreover , permits and rubbish handling costs need to be factored in also.
